Glad you were able to get out to the claim.  Keep swinging Gfox.  Now that you have a preferred  detector (e.g., the 800), try focusing on getting to know that one inside and out so that you can start building your muscle memory on the audio and visual indicators for various targets, including gold.  Avoid switching off now until you really get to know one of those detectors to avoid resetting your learning curve on your favorite detector and then when you feel confident, break out that GPX and start learning that.  It will be a completely different animal but worth it.  Good luck.
